Milwaukee Open

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

The Milwaukee Open was a golf tournament on the PGA Tour, played only in 1940. It was played at the North Hills Country Club in Menomonee Falls, Wisconsin. Ralph Guldahl won the event by four shots over Johnny Bulla.[1]
